Arundo Re looks to growth in Indian sub-continent with appointment of Kshitij Chirimar

Chirimar joins the business as Senior Underwriter for the region.

Arundo Re on Monday announced it had appointed Kshitij Chirimar as Senior Underwriter for the Indian sub-continent, a move the business labelled as a “significant step” in expanding its presence in the region.

Chirimar joins the French reinsurer following more than 12 years at ACE Insurance Brokers and he has a career which has centred on structuring solutions and business development in India, Central Asia, and East Asia.

“Kshitij’s expertise in the Indian sub-continent is a real asset for Arundo Re,” said Hervé Nessi, Chief Underwriting Officer at Arundo Re. “His in-depth knowledge of the local issues and his solid relationships with key players in this market will strengthen our position in this strategic region for the company.”

Chirimar also holds a degree in Financial Analysis from the University of Delhi and is a Fellow of the Insurance Institute of India.
